What the Data Says About Knox

The Social Security Administration has registered 22,294 babies named Knox between 1881 and 2024, spanning 144 consecutive years of U.S. birth records. As a boy's name, Knox currently holds the #209 rank among boys for 2024. The name reached its historical peak in 2022, when 1,900 babies received it in a single year.

Decade-level aggregation shows that Knox performed strongest in the 2010s, accumulating 12,053 births during that ten-year window. Across the 15 decades of recorded activity, Knox shows a stable profile with only moderate drift from its peak decade. Geographically, the name is most concentrated in Texas, which accounts for 2,460 births — the largest state-level total in the dataset — followed by Tennessee and California. In total, SSA state-level files list Knox in 50 of the 51 U.S. reporting jurisdictions.

These figures derive from SSA's annual national and state-level name files, which include any name appearing at least five times in a given year or state-year; names below that threshold are suppressed for privacy and therefore excluded from the totals shown here. The 22,294 total represents a lower bound — actual usage may be higher in years or states where the count fell below the disclosure floor.
